NEW YORK โ€” Zohran Mamdani defied the odds, defeating former New York Gov. Andrew Cuomo on Tuesday night and becoming mayor in an election that saw 2 million voters cast ballots.

Just months ago, when Mamdani entered the race, he was polling in the single digits and few believed he could defeat Cuomo.

In the end, Mamdani defeated him twice.

And in a year when Democrats have largely been floundering, Mamdani electrified the party and managed to draw new voters to the polls too.

So why did he win so decisively?

Here are five reasons:

Affordability trumped all

While Cuomo focused his primary campaign on issues like crime and safety, Mamdani homed in on affordability in a city that has long been viewed as way too expensive. And his campaign ran so hard on that issue, it became synonymous with his campaign from start to finish.

At campaign rallies, Mamdani frequently stood in front of signs reading, โ€œA City We Can Afford.โ€ A visit to his website also plainly states that Mamdani is โ€œrunning for Mayor to lower the cost of living for working class New Yorkers.โ€ His supporters also carried placards reading โ€œBuild Affordable Housingโ€ and โ€œChildcare for all.โ€

Morris Katz, who served as a strategist for the Mamdani campaign, told The Hill in an interview that the broader narrative for Mamdaniโ€™s campaign was โ€œLife doesnโ€™t have to be this hard. New York can be more affordable and itโ€™s governmentโ€™s job to deliver that.โ€

His message was consistent

In the aftermath of last yearโ€™s elections, Democrats have spent a considerable amount of time thinking about messaging. One of the criticisms of Hillary Clintonโ€™s 2016 presidential campaign and Kamala Harrisโ€™s 2024 presidential campaign was that voters couldnโ€™t figure out what each candidate stood for and what rationale they had for running.

Mamdani never had that problem.

โ€œWhen you have Trump voters supporting a democratic socialist, you are communicating something pretty clearly and consistently,โ€ said Democratic strategist Eddie Vale.

โ€œIf you watch Zohranโ€™s launch video, and then you watch the first ad of the primary campaign and then if you look at our messaging in the general, it has been the same campaign the entire campaign,โ€ Katz told The Hill.
